wget option to download a directory


I have difficulties in getting the option right for wget to download
directories from http://aufs.cvs.sourceforge.net/viewvc/aufs/aufs
Anyone could advise on this. Thanks.

actually i am looking for a tarball for aufs module but couldn't find. so i think i need to download all the associated directories and files in the above mentioned URL before i could install the aufs module.

I key in the following code.
Code:
wget -i files_aufs -c -B http://aufs.cvs.sourceforge.net/viewvc/aufs/aufs
.

It only fetch a index.html file! The files_aufs has the entry of "fs" and "include" which suppose to tell wget to get the "fs" and "include" directories from the URL.

Appreciate anyone could shed some light on this.

Thanks a lot.

Did you attempt the wget command with a -r for recursive retrieval?

man wget for all available options.
